Managed Services CRM Software (2026)
Managed services providers (MSPs) need a CRM that tracks more than just leads and deals. Your CRM should manage client contracts, service level agreements (SLAs), technician assignments, and recurring revenue streams. It must also support ticketing, asset management, and seamless handoffs between sales, onboarding, and support teams. Look for a CRM that integrates with your PSA (professional services automation) tools and offers robust reporting on client health and technician productivity.
The best CRMs for managed services balance automation with flexibility. They should reduce manual data entry while allowing customization for unique workflows. Some CRMs are built specifically for MSPs, while others are general-purpose tools with strong customization options. The right choice depends on your team’s size, budget, and integration needs. Frequently asked
Do I need a CRM built specifically for managed services?
Not necessarily. While some CRMs cater to MSPs, general-purpose CRMs with strong customization and integration capabilities can also work well. The key is ensuring the CRM supports your workflows, including contract management and technician assignments.
How do I choose between a CRM and a PSA tool?
CRMs focus on client relationships and sales pipelines, while PSAs manage service delivery and operations. Many MSPs use both, with the CRM handling sales and the PSA managing service delivery. Look for tools that integrate seamlessly to avoid data silos.
